The node editor offers a better overview over how an asset is connected. Currently this is used for Roleplay.
Controls:
| Input | Description |
|---|---|
| Click & Drag On Background | Pans the node view. |
| Click & Drag On Block Header | Moves a node. |
| Click & Drag On Block Node | Draws a new node connection. Nodes can be connected right and left side of a block, and must match by color. |
| Ctrl + Click & Drag | Drags a selection box, allowing you to select multiple blocks. |
| Right Click on Background | Opens the global context menu (see below). |
| Right Click On Block | Opens the block context menu (see below). |
| Right Click On Background With Multiple Selctions | Opens the batch context menu (see below). |
| Shift + Click & Drag Block Header | Clones the block (or all selected blocks if you have an active multi-block selection). |
| Mousewheel | Zooms |
| Shift + Right Click On Block | Resets block connection positions. |
| Right Click on Line | Opens the line context menu (see below). |
| Option | Description |
|---|---|
| + <blockType> | Inserts a new block of this type. |
| Pan To Root | Pans to the root node. |
| Purge Position | Resets all positions (can be useful is you've lost the node positions). |
| Minimize All | Minimizes all Blocks |
| Maximize All | Maximizes all Blocks. |
